Dr. Thomas F. Cannon
Dr. Cannon is an active partner with the San Antonio tourism community. He has served as a City Council appointed commissioner to the San Antonio Convention & Visitors Commission where he was chairman of its Budget and Finance Committee overseeing a $14.5 million dollar budget including oversight of the Alamodome and Henry B. Gonzalez Convention Center.
He was formerly elected vice chairman of the Board of Directors of the 250-plus member San Antonio Area Tourism Council and was a member of the Executive Committee of Destination SA which is the city's first comprehensive strategic plan to grow the tourism industry by an additional $2 billion annually.
Among the diverse research projects that he has served as an investigator are the economic impact on San Antonio of the Dallas Cowboys Training Camp and the Alamo Bowl, the successful date change of the state's popular Texas Folklife Festival and the business projections and economic assessment for the Dolph and Janey Briscoe Western Art Museum. He is frequently sought out and quoted by the media as to his opinion on tourism related issues.

Dr. David Bojanic
Anheuser-Busch Foundation Professorship in Tourism
Dr. Bojanic is the co-author of two books in hospitality and tourism marketing: Hospitality Marketing Management and Hospitality Sales: Selling Smarter. A prolific researcher, his articles continue to be published in top tourism journals such as the Journal of Travel Research, Annals of Tourism Research, Tourism Management, Journal of Hospitality and Tourism Research, and Journal of Travel and Tourism Marketing. He also serves on the editorial review board for three tourism and hospitality academic journals.
His consulting expertise has been sought by such tourism and hospitality organizations as the Greater Springfield Convention and Visitors' Bureau, Smuggler's Notch Resort, Marriott International, Sentosa Leisure Group and the Resort and Commercial Recreation Association.
He earned his Doctorate of Business Administration degree in Marketing from the University of Kentucky and specializes in tourism and hospitality marketing; a Master of Business Administration degree from James Madison University and his Bachelor of Science degree in Marketing from Pennsylvania State University.
Dr. Victor Heller
Director of Executive Education
Dr. Victor L. Heller is the Director of Executive Education, Learning Community Advocate (Ethics Officer) and an Associate Professor of Marketing at the University of Texas at San Antonio.
His 36-year career has blended academic and practical experiences. He has taught at Arizona State University, Northern Arizona University and the American Graduate School of International Management (Thunderbird).
Dr. Heller’s practitioner experiences include CEO of a non-profit tourism association, CFO of a not-for-profit organization, registered lobbyist for the tourism industry, director of a state tourism agency, university administrator and an assistant to a mayor, a city manager and a university president.
